The Human Invasion

We have often heard of the spread of invasive species, plant species like Japanese knotweed in Ireland, for instance. We come up with measures to remove them, so they do not wreak havoc on the local plant species and land.  Yet we have not really considered the most destructive and invasive species of them all. 

Us Humans. 

We are exhausting our freshwater supply, filling our environment with waste, exploiting natural resources to extract oil, gas and raw materials.  

Everything we ourselves need to survive; we are destroying it.  We have shown concern as our hunting and pillaging habits have brought plant and animal species to extinction globally.  Our concern is met with very little preventative action though. As a species we are the catalysts of our own demise.
